ACE 2021 Uganda Fall Training

SCHEDULE

BCBB Instructor Subject Topics Date
David Stern Population Genetics & Genomics Hardy-Weinberg Equilibrium ( Materials, Video ) 21-Oct-2021
Kurt Wollenberg Principles of Sequence analysis and Phylogenetics Dynamic programming and Alignment algorithms ( Materials, Video ) 25-Oct-2021
Kurt Wollenberg Molecular Evolution Calculating evolutionary distances among sequences and correction models ( Materials, Video ) 1-Nov-2021
Eric Karlins Population Genetics & Genomics GWAS tutorial ( Materials, Video ) 4-Nov-2021
Hernan Lorenzi Systems Biology 2 Cytoscape - StringApp ( Materials, Video ) 8-Nov-2021
Burke Squires BioPython Introduction to BioPython ( Materials, Video ) 10-Nov-2021
Kurt Wollenberg Principles of Sequence analysis and Phylogenetics Introduction to phylogenetics and phylogenetic tree inference methods (e.g. parsimony and Maximum Likelihood) ( Materials, Video ) 15-Nov-2021
Andrew Oler Population Genetics & Genomics Genetic Linkage Analysis and homozygosity mapping ( Materials, Video ) 30-Nov-2021
Burke Squires Systems Biology 2 Reactome Tutorial of Biological Networks ( Materials, Video ) 1-Dec-2021
Isaac Raplee Disease Dynamics and Modelling Modelling the transmission of STIs ( Materials, Video ) 2-Dec-2021
Kurt Wollenberg Principles of Sequence analysis and Phylogenetics Coalescent analysis and populations ( Materials, Video ) 6-Dec-2021
Burke Squires BioPython Bio.PopGen: Population genetics ( Materials, Video ) 8-Dec-2021
Burke Squires BioPython Graphics including GenomeDiagram ( Materials, Video ) 15-Dec-2021
Dan Veltri Big Bio-data Analysis (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ning) Intro to Deep Learning (TensorFlow and Keras) ( Materials, Video ) ?

INSTRUCTORS

Computational Biology Specialists from the National Institute of Allergy and Infectious Diseases (NIAID) will be teaching courses on bioinformatics topics and biocomputing tools.

  • Eric Karlins, Ph.D.*

  • Hernan Lorenzi, Ph.D.*

  • Andrew Oler, Ph.D.

  • Isaac Raplee,Ph.D.*

  • R. Burke Squires, M.S.*

  • David Stern, Ph.D.*

  • Dan Veltri, Ph.D.

  • Kurt Wollenberg, Ph.D.*

    * Instructors provide bioinformatics support at the NIAID as employees of Medical Science and Computing, Inc.
